The Importance of Clinical Research

Clinical research serves as the backbone of modern medicine, providing the evidence necessary to evaluate the safety and efficacy of new treatments. It is through clinical trials that researchers can determine how a new drug or therapy interacts with the human body, identifying both its potential benefits and risks. This process is crucial for ensuring that new medical interventions are not only effective but also safe for public use.

Without clinical research, the advancement of medical science would stagnate, leaving patients without access to potentially life-saving therapies. Moreover, clinical research plays a vital role in understanding disease mechanisms and patient responses to treatment. By studying diverse populations and various health conditions, researchers can uncover insights that lead to personalized medicine—tailoring treatments to individual patient needs based on genetic, environmental, and lifestyle factors.

This shift towards precision medicine is transforming healthcare, allowing for more targeted and effective interventions that improve patient outcomes.

The Role of Patients in Clinical Research

Patients are not merely subjects in clinical research; they are essential partners in the quest for medical advancement. At Helios Clinical Research, patient involvement is recognized as a cornerstone of successful trials. By actively engaging patients in the research process, Helios ensures that their voices are heard and their needs are addressed.

This collaborative approach fosters trust between researchers and participants, ultimately leading to more meaningful results. Involving patients in clinical research can take many forms, from participation in focus groups that shape study design to providing feedback on informed consent documents. Furthermore, Helios encourages patients to share their experiences and perspectives throughout the trial process.

This input can lead to improvements in study protocols and help identify potential barriers to participation. By valuing patient insights, Helios not only enhances the quality of its research but also empowers individuals to take an active role in their healthcare journey.
